Shop Atmosphere

Hildi operates on a strict 'don't ask, don't tell' code. She always keeps one chest nailed shut and one chest open for inspection. She speaks three languages, tells stories of each place she passed through, and always attempts to upsell worthless trinkets as 'seafolk relics'. Haggling is expected; she offers favors for rumors, small jobs, or safe passage.
